> SET GLOBAL time_zone = '+2:00'; has the mostly same effect as writing > default-time-zone= "-05:00" to /etc/my.cnf The difference is that using SET GLOBAL does not persist the setting across MySQL starts. You should write this setting into the configuration file to make it permanent.
